The Enduring Appeal of the Willys Jeep
The Willys-Overland MB, alongside the Ford GPW, was the original "Jeep" that served valiantly during WWII, becoming an indispensable tool for Allied forces. Its compact size, four-wheel drive, and robust construction made it perfect for navigating challenging terrains. Post-war, Willys recognized the civilian demand for such a versatile vehicle, leading to the creation of the CJ (Civilian Jeep) series.
Models like the CJ-2A ("AgriJeep"), CJ-3A, CJ-3B (with its distinctive high hood), and the later CJ-5 all carry the Willys legacy. Each model offers unique characteristics, but they all share the fundamental Willys DNA: a robust frame, simple mechanics, and an open-air design that invites adventure. What to Inspect Before You Buy: A Buyer’s Checklist
Once you find a promising listing, schedule an in-person viewing. This is your most critical step. Bring a flashlight, a magnet, and a knowledgeable friend if possible.
- Rust (The Silent Killer): This is paramount. Willys Jeeps are notorious for rust.
- Frame: Inspect the entire frame for cracks, bends, or severe rust through. Pay attention to spring hangers and body mounts.
- Body Tub: Check floorboards, inner fenders, cowl, and especially the hat channels under the floor. A magnet can help detect bondo over rust.
- Fenders & Grille: Common rust spots.
- Engine & Drivetrain:
- Leaks: Look for oil, coolant, or differential fluid leaks.
- Starting: Does it start easily? Listen for unusual noises (knocks, clunks, grinding).
- Transmission/Transfer Case: Check fluid levels. Test shifting (if manual) and engagement of 4WD (high and low range).
- Differential: Check for excessive play in drive shafts.
- Brakes & Suspension:
- Brakes: Check pedal feel, master cylinder leaks, and condition of lines.
- Suspension: Look for worn leaf springs, shackles, and shocks.
- Steering: Check for excessive play in the steering wheel and steering components.
- Electrical System: Test all lights (headlights, tail lights, turn signals), horn, wipers, and gauges. Look for frayed or aftermarket wiring.
- Tires: Check condition, age, and matching set.

Pricing Your Willys Jeep: What to Expect
The price of a Willys Jeep varies wildly based on several factors. Craigslist prices are often lower than those found at specialized dealerships or auctions.
- Condition: This is the biggest factor.
- Project Vehicle: Non-running, significant rust, missing parts. Can range from $1,000 – $5,000.
- Running Driver: Functional, but needs work, some rust, cosmetic flaws. Can range from $5,000 – $15,000.
- Nicely Restored/Original Condition: Excellent shape, minimal rust, well-maintained or professionally restored. Can range from $15,000 – $35,000+ (some rare military models or show-quality restorations can exceed this).
- Model Rarity: MB/GPW military Jeeps often command higher prices than common CJ-2As, though a pristine CJ-2A can still be valuable. CJ-3B (high-hood) models are somewhat rarer than 2As/3As. Willys Wagons and Pickups also have their own market.
- Location: Prices can vary regionally based on demand and availability.
- Included Parts/Accessories: A Willys with extra parts, hardtops, or special equipment might fetch more.
Market Research is Key: Before making an offer, check other "sold" listings on eBay, Bring a Trailer, or other classic car sites to get a sense of current market value for similar conditions and models.
Tips for a Successful Transaction
- Communicate Clearly: Ask specific questions about the vehicle’s history, maintenance, and any known issues.
- Negotiate Respectfully: Be prepared to negotiate, but be realistic. Don’t insult the seller with a ridiculously low offer. Back up your offer with observed flaws or market research.
- Secure Payment: For local deals, cash or a cashier’s check from a reputable bank are safest. Avoid wiring money or using services like Zelle/Venmo for large transactions with strangers. Meet at a bank for the exchange if possible.
- Title Transfer: This is non-negotiable. Ensure you receive a signed-over title immediately upon payment. Understand your state’s specific requirements for title transfer and registration.
- Transportation: Plan how you’ll get the Jeep home. If it’s a project or non-runner, you’ll need a trailer. Even running vehicles can have issues on a long drive.
